The XRT8001IDTR-F is a dual-phase-locked loop chip designed for generating low jitter output clock signals suitable for synchronization in wide area networking systems. It can produce two integer multiples of 8kHz, 56kHz, and 64kHz while locking onto incoming reference frequencies of 1.54MHz (T1), 2.048MHz (E1), 8kHz, 56kHz, or 64kHz. The device features pre-programmed multipliers and dividers that can be selected via a serial port, allowing for flexible configuration. This clock generator operates in six different modes, including Forward/Master, Reverse/Master, and Slave modes, among others. It supports output clock frequencies ranging from 8kHz to 16.384MHz and provides sync output options of 8kHz or 64kHz. The XRT8001IDTR-F is designed for low power consumption (40 - 100mW) and operates within a temperature range of -40¬8C to +85¬8C. It is available in an 18-lead SOIC package and is pin compatible with the XRT8000 series, making it a versatile choice for various applications, including T1/E1 access equipment, ISDN routers, and system synchronizers.
